United Nations Global Compact

The United Nations Global Compact is a voluntary initiative that encourages businesses worldwide to adopt sustainable and socially responsible practices. Launched in 2000, it focuses on ten principles related to human rights, labor, environment, and anti-corruption. Companies that join commit to aligning their operations and strategies with these principles, promoting ethical business practices. By fostering collaboration between businesses, governments, and civil society, the Global Compact aims to create a more sustainable and inclusive global economy, ultimately supporting the UN's broader goals for peace, prosperity, and environmental protection.
